WHAT DOCUMENTS
ARE NEEDED FOR THE VISA

A complete list for your situation — nothing extra, nothing missed
MANDATORY

Required to apply

Basic documents for everyone

  • Passport (valid for at least 6 months)
  • DS-160 confirmation page
  • Interview appointment confirmation
  • Current photo in digital and printed form
BY STATUS & PURPOSE

Business purpose and legalization

Depends on your situation

  • Residence card, EU resident, PESEL UKR, national D visa or Schengen
  • Invitation letter from a US company
  • Contract, draft agreement, or event program
  • Rental agreement or registration (meldunek)
  • Corporate documents of the applicant's company
STRENGTHEN THE CASE

Increase approval chances

Additional guarantees

  • Bank statement (around 5000 USD)
  • Tax returns
  • Employment certificate or business registration docs (JDG, Sp. z o.o.)
  • Property documents
  • Previous visa history
STEP 1

Consultation

Free assessment of your chances and visa strategy selection.

STEP 2

Invitation Preparation

An invitation letter from the US host is a key document for a business visa. We help to properly formulate the purpose of the meeting and the business nature of the visit.

STEP 3

Application Form

Filling out the DS-160 online form on the official US embassy website; receiving a confirmation with a personal barcode.

STEP 4

Visa Fee Payment

The mandatory MRV Fee is charged for processing your application and is non-refundable.

STEP 5

Scheduling the Interview

You need to schedule an interview at the US Embassy in Poland. The waiting time ranges from a few days to several weeks.

STEP 6

Document Preparation

Prepare all required papers: passport, 5x5 photos, DS-160 barcode form, visa fee payment receipt, and documents proving the purpose of your trip.

STEP 7

The Interview

During the interview, the officer may ask questions about the purpose of your trip, your plans, financial status, and more.

STEP 8

Receiving the Decision

After the interview, you will immediately be informed of the decision regarding the issuance of your US visa.

Processing and Issuance Times:

  • Embassy queue is from a few days to a couple of weeks.
  • Visa decision: announced immediately at the interview.
  • Printing and passport issuance: takes on average 3 to 5 business days.

Validity and Entry Rules:

  • Validity: the B1/B2 visa is issued for 1 to 10 years, depending on citizenship.
  • Entries: the visa is multiple-entry;
  • Length of stay: the actual time allowed in the States is determined by the border control officer at each entry (usually 180 days).

U.S. Embassy in Warsaw

This is the main diplomatic mission accepting applications for non-immigrant (B1/B2) and immigrant visas.

Address: Aleje Ujazdowskie 29/31, 00-540 Warszawa, Poland;
Phone: +48 22 504 2000;
Hours: Mon–Fri, 08:30–17:00.

U.S. Consulate General in Krakow

The Consulate in Krakow also conducts tourist visa interviews and is convenient for residents of southern Poland.

Address: ul. Stolarska 9, 31-043 Kraków, Poland;
Phone: +48 12 424 5100
Hours: Mon–Fri, 08:30–17:00.

EVERYTHING YOU NEED TO KNOW BEFORE APPLYING

01

Is an invitation from a US company required for a business visa?

Formally no, but without it the chances drop significantly. The consular officer needs to understand who is inviting you, for what purpose, and that the trip is genuinely business-related rather than tourism disguised as business.
02

What should be included in the invitation letter from a US company?

The company name and address, the name and position of the inviting person, the purpose of the visit, meeting dates, and confirmation of who covers the expenses — the American side or your company.
03

Do I need a letter from my employer if I am traveling for a business trip?

04

What documents confirm the business purpose of the trip?

Contracts or negotiation letters with an American partner, a conference or event program, registration for a business event, and business correspondence.
05

Can I be refused a business visa if I do not have an official employer?

This is a more difficult case, but not a dead end. Sole proprietors, freelancers, and business owners are also accepted — it is important to properly prove income, business activity, and the real purpose of the trip.
06

What are the main reasons for refusal of a B1 business visa?

Lack of a clear business purpose, weak or missing invitation from the American side, low income or unstable employment, and inconsistencies between the purpose of the trip and the applicant’s profile.
07

What should I do if I already received a refusal for a business visa?

You need to understand what exactly concerned the consular officer and fix the weak points. Most often it is an unconvincing business purpose or a weak financial profile. Reapplying with the right strategy can bring a good result.
08

Does the size or reputation of my company affect the decision?

Yes. Employees of large international companies usually raise fewer questions. If the company is small, it is important to compensate with strong documents and a clear explanation of the trip.
09

What questions are asked during a business visa interview?

What is the purpose of your trip, who are you meeting with, who is paying for the trip, what is your position and how long have you worked for the company, and whether you plan to return after the trip.
10

Should I bring contracts and business documents to the interview?

It is advisable to have key documents with you — the invitation letter, employer letter, and event program. The consular officer may ask to see them during the interview.
11

Can I speak Russian or Ukrainian during the interview?

Yes. Consular officers in Warsaw (and in Krakow with an interpreter) work with Russian-speaking applicants. English is not a requirement for obtaining a visa.
12

What if the consular officer doubts the business nature of the trip?

The officer may ask additional questions or request more documents. This is not a refusal — it is important to calmly and clearly explain the purpose of the trip. We prepare clients specifically for such situations.
13

How much is the consular fee for a B1 business visa?

$185 — a fixed embassy fee, the same for tourist and business visas. It is non-refundable even in case of refusal.
14

How long is a B1 business visa issued for?

Usually for 1, 5, or 10 years with multiple entries. Each stay can last up to 6 months, determined by the US border officer.
15

How long does the business visa process take?

Usually from 2 to 4 weeks from the moment of scheduling the interview. In urgent cases we help expedite the appointment.
16

Can I combine tourism and business purposes in one trip with a B1 visa?

Yes. The B1/B2 visa is issued as a combined visa and allows both business meetings and tourism during the same trip.
17

Can I apply for a business visa while staying in Poland without a residence card?

Technically yes, but having legal status in Poland significantly strengthens the application. A residence card or a valid Schengen visa is a serious advantage.
18

Does previous travel experience to the US or Europe matter?

Yes. Travel history is one of the strongest positive signals for a consular officer. It shows that you returned home and respected visa rules.
19

Can a sole proprietor or business owner get a B1 business visa?

Yes. Business owners travel for negotiations, exhibitions, and conferences — this fully matches the B1 category. It is important to document the existence of the business and the business purpose of the trip.
20

Do I need to confirm hotel reservations and a return ticket?

A return ticket and hotel reservation are not mandatory documents.
